Google Brings Tensor G5 And AI To Pixel 10a

Google is preparing to launch the Pixel 10a in the coming weeks, a midrange phone expected to include the flagship Tensor G5 chip, a 6.3-inch 120Hz OLED, and upgraded camera hardware. Reports indicate the device will run full Gemini AI features and offer seven years of OS and security updates, potentially retailing at or below $499. The combination positions Google to reshape midrange competitiveness and accelerate on-device AI adoption.
